Charles R. Thomas, Jr., M.D. is the inaugural Chair and Chief of the Department of Radiation Oncology & Applied Sciences. Dr. Thomas is a 1979 graduate of Dartmouth College. In addition to leading the department, he is a Professor of Medicine at Geisel and has served as Associate Director for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ion at the Dartmouth Cancer Center. He joined Geisel and Dartmouth Health in September 2021, coming from Oregon health & Science University where he was the Chair of the Department of Radiation Medicine. His professional interests include clinical and translational cancer research, particularly in developing therapeutic clinical trials for gastrointestinal and thoracic solid tumors. He is also deeply involved in mentorship and strategies to increase diversity in cancer medicine.
